The Lake County sheriff’s deputy who suffered serious injuries during a crash while responding to a call in Beach Park has been released from the hospital.

The Lake County Sheriff’s Office received a call around 9:42 p.m. Saturday of a person armed with a knife trying to break into a home in the 13400 block of Victoria Lane in Beach Park.

One of the sheriff’s deputies responding to the call was traveling westbound on Wadsworth Road, according to Lake County Sheriff Spokesman Sgt. Christopher Covelli.

The sheriff’s deputy’s squad car, which had its emergency lights activated, collided with a southbound Nissan Rogue, driven by a 28-year-old woman, in the intersection of Wadsworth Road and Green Bay Road in Beach Park.

The collision caused the Nissan to strike an eastbound Honda Civic, driven by a 19-year-old woman, Covelli said.

The sheriff’s deputy and the driver of the Nissan were transported to Advocate Condell Medical Center in Libertyville with serious but non-life-threatening injuries.

The driver of Honda and its passenger, a 13-year-old girl, did not appear to have any injuries.

On Sunday, the sheriff’s deputy was discharged from Advocate Condell Medical Center. The 28-year-old woman, whose condition has stabilized, remained in the hospital on Monday.

Covelli said the Lake County Sheriff’s Office requested the Lake County Major Crash Assistance Team (MCAT) to respond and conduct an independent investigation.

A juvenile was taken into custody during the original call that the deputy was responding to and charges are pending against them.

The investigation into the crash remains ongoing by the Major Crash Assistance Team.
